• Conference Session Tracks •
SDG-Aligned Research Themes
ICTIEG conference tracks support global knowledge exchange, innovation, and sustainable development priorities across diverse disciplines.
01 The Role of Technology in Economic Growth +
This track explores the relationship between technological advancements and economic growth, focusing on how innovations drive productivity and enhance competitive advantage. Papers may analyze case studies or theoretical frameworks that illustrate the impact of technology on various economic sectors.
02 Innovation Policies and Economic Development +
This session examines the effectiveness of innovation policies in fostering economic development and enhancing national competitiveness. Contributions may include empirical analyses of policy impacts on R&D investment and innovation outcomes across different regions.
03 Knowledge Spillovers and Industry Transformation +
This track investigates the mechanisms through which knowledge spillovers contribute to industry transformation and economic resilience. Researchers are encouraged to present models or case studies that highlight the role of collaboration and networks in facilitating innovation.
04 Productivity Measurement in the Digital Economy +
This session focuses on new methodologies and frameworks for measuring productivity in the context of the digital economy. Contributions may address challenges and opportunities presented by digital technologies and their implications for traditional productivity metrics.
05 Entrepreneurship and Technological Change +
This track delves into the interplay between entrepreneurship and technological change, examining how new ventures leverage innovation to disrupt markets. Papers may explore the factors that influence entrepreneurial success in high-tech industries.
06 Market Dynamics and Technology Diffusion +
This session analyzes the dynamics of markets in relation to technology diffusion, focusing on how innovations spread across industries and geographies. Contributions may include empirical studies that assess the factors influencing the rate and extent of technology adoption.
07 R&D Investment and Economic Performance +
This track investigates the relationship between R&D investment and economic performance, emphasizing the role of innovation in driving growth. Papers may explore sector-specific analyses or comparative studies across countries.
08 Innovation Systems and Economic Resilience +
This session examines the concept of innovation systems and their role in enhancing economic resilience in times of crisis. Contributions may include theoretical frameworks or empirical studies that highlight the importance of collaborative networks in fostering innovation.
09 Patents and Innovation: A Double-Edged Sword +
This track explores the complex relationship between patents and innovation, discussing how intellectual property rights can both incentivize and hinder technological progress. Researchers are invited to present analyses of patent systems and their impact on innovation dynamics.
10 ICT Adoption and Economic Growth +
This session focuses on the role of Information and Communication Technology (ICT) adoption in driving economic growth and enhancing productivity. Papers may analyze the barriers to ICT adoption and the resulting implications for economic development.
11 Economic Modeling of High-Tech Industries +
This track invites contributions that utilize economic modeling to analyze the dynamics of high-tech industries and their contribution to overall economic growth. Researchers may present theoretical models or empirical analyses that shed light on industry-specific trends and challenges.
